Gary Neville laughs at how ‘badly’ Manchester United played and suggests they pulled off difficult ‘skill’ against Brentford
Gary Neville couldn't help but laugh at how 'horrible' Manchester United's performance was against Brentford on Saturday.The result for United scuppers any remaining hope they had left of finishing in the top four, and club legend, he said: "I watched them last night and suppose like everyone else couldn't believe really what I was watching.
Neville then offered a slight giggle before further revealing that what he saw was worrying ahead of the season run-in: "Honestly, it really is you know. "Manchester United, I can't think of any point in that game, maybe the first few minutes, but I can't think of any point in that game where they did anything well at all.
"You know you can play badly in football, you know you can have players missing, you know you can miss chances, you know that sometimes you don't feel quite right. But that was a dismal, dismal effort in an attempt to play football."
